Statement
​​My art practice uses a slow meditative and ancient process of forming hollow vessels from metal, it is so physically demanding that each project becomes a deliberate act in making, in theory the form could be produced using other less demanding means, but it is this physical exertion and ritual between myself, the metal and hammer that is central to my work.   Each new project evolves from the previous one, stretching the elements of metal, hammer energy and design, moving away from traditional forms of vessels made in this process. My ideas delve through  a subconscious comic science fiction,  using anthropomorphism to find a playfulness and individual character in each piece, using  block colour of  traditional patination to emphasise these elements. ​
